Samalwas (672) is an inhabited village in Bali Chowki Sub-district of Mandi district, Himachal Pradesh. Its Census village code is 015019, the Census 2011 record lists 588 people in 112 households and the reported area is 116.77 hectares. The local references include Seraj CD Block and the nearest town reference is Mandi at about 80 km.

Population and Social Groups
The Census 2011 record lists 588 people in 112 households, with 294 male residents and 294 female residents. The average household size is 5.25, and SC share is 17.69% and ST share is 0% for Samalwas (672). Population density works out to about 503.55 people per sq km.

Land Use and Local Economy
Land-use records for Samalwas (672) show that reported agricultural commodities include Maize, Wehat and Paddy and net sown area is 59.03 hectares. These figures help explain village agriculture and local economy context.
